Hit Enter to search or Esc key to close
Blog thumbnail

Olduvai Gorge Museum

Olduvai Gorge Museum

Blog thumbnail ,

The Olduvai Gorge Museum is located in the Ngorongoro Conservation Area in northern Tanzania, on the edge of the Olduvai Gorge. It’s one of the most important paleoanthropological sites in the world; it has proven invaluable in furthering understanding of early human evolution.